1284) Which of the following lasers provides an effective treatment option for "RESIDUAL telangiectasia following infantile cervicofacial hemangioma involution"
A. 532-nm diode laser
B. Flash pumped dye laser (PDL)
C. Nd:YAG laser
D. CO2 laser
E. KTP lase
REFERENCES & ANSWER
1284) A 532-nm diode laser
Cerrati E. W. , Teresa M.O., Chung H., Waner M.: Diode Laser for the Treatment of Telangiectasias following Hemangioma Involution, Otolaryngology-Head and Neck Surg., 2015, Vol. 152 (2), pp.239-243
